3 Insert the voltage converter into the cigarette lighter socket. If necessary, clean the
cigarette lighter socket to obtain a good electrical contact.
4 Turn down the volume and connect the cassette adapter plug to the LINE OUT/p
socket of the CD player.
5 Carefully insert the cassette adapter into the car radioOs cassette compartment.
6 Make sure the cord does not hinder your driving.
7 Start the CD-player, set VOL E to position 8 and adjust the sound with the car
radio controls.
Y Always remove the voltage converter from the cigarette lighter socket when the
CD-player is not in use.
Note: � Avoid excessive heat from the car heating or from direct sunlight (e.g. in a
parked car in the summer).
� If your car radio has a LINE IN socket, it is better to use this instead of the
cassette adapter. Simply connect a signal lead from the LINEOUT/p socket
of the CD-player to this LINE IN socket.
